To decorate a mango cheesecake, you can follow these steps:
- Start by preparing the mangoes. Peel and slice the mangoes into thin, even slices. Set aside.
- Once your cheesecake is fully chilled and set, remove it from the refrigerator. Make sure it is at room temperature before proceeding with the decoration.
- Apply a thin layer of mango puree on top of the cheesecake. This can be done using a pastry brush or the back of a spoon. Ensure that the puree is evenly spread across the surface.
- Arrange the mango slices in a pattern on top of the cheesecake. You can create a circular pattern starting from the outer edge or any other design of your choice. Be creative with the way you place the slices.
- Add a few small pieces of diced mango in between the larger slices. This will add texture and visual appeal to the decoration.
- If desired, you can dust a light sprinkling of powdered sugar on top of the mango slices. This adds a touch of elegance and finishes off the decoration.
- Once decorated, return the cheesecake to the refrigerator for at least an hour, or until ready to serve. This allows the mango slices to set and ensures the flavors meld together.
- Just before serving, you can garnish the cheesecake with a few mint leaves or a drizzle of caramel or chocolate sauce for added visual appeal.
Remember, decorating a mango cheesecake is a creative process, and you can adapt these steps to suit your preference and style. Let your imagination run wild and have fun experimenting with different designs and toppings!
How to make a mango cheesecake stand out with a mirror glaze decoration on top?
To make a mango cheesecake stand out with a mirror glaze decoration on top, you can follow these steps:
- Bake the cheesecake: Start by preparing a mango cheesecake of your choice. Use a recipe that incorporates fresh mangos into the cheesecake filling to enhance the mango flavor. After baking, let the cheesecake cool completely.
- Prepare the mirror glaze: In a small bowl, bloom gelatin by adding cold water and letting it soften for a few minutes. In a saucepan, combine water, sugar, and corn syrup. Heat the mixture over medium heat until it comes to a boil. Remove the saucepan from heat and add the bloomed gelatin, stirring until completely dissolved. Allow the glaze mixture to cool slightly.
- Add mango puree: Puree fresh mango chunks in a blender until smooth. Pass the puree through a sieve to remove any fibrous bits. Add the mango puree to the slightly cooled glaze mixture and whisk until well combined.
- Color the glaze (optional): If desired, you can add a food coloring gel to the glaze mixture to give it a vibrant mango color. Gel colors work better than liquid colors, as they don't affect the consistency of the glaze.
- Glaze the cake: Place the cheesecake on a wire rack over a baking sheet or clean surface to catch the excess glaze. Slowly pour the mango mirror glaze over the top of the cheesecake, ensuring that it spreads evenly and covers the surface completely. Allow the glaze to drip down the sides of the cake. You can use a spatula to spread the glaze evenly if needed.
- Smooth the edges: Once the glaze has settled slightly, use a small offset spatula to smooth the edges of the glaze, ensuring a clean finish. This step will make the mirror glaze look more polished.
- Decorate: Before the glaze sets completely, you can decorate the mango cheesecake by adding fresh mango slices, toasted coconut flakes, or edible flowers on top. Arrange them creatively to make the cake visually appealing.
- Chill and set: Carefully transfer the mango cheesecake to a refrigerator and allow it to chill for at least 4 hours or overnight to let the mirror glaze set and the flavors to meld.
- Serve: Once fully set, remove the mango cheesecake from the refrigerator. Slice it into portions and serve chilled. The glossy mirror glaze will beautifully enhance the appearance of your mango cheesecake, making it stand out and delight your guests.
